ISM manufacturing index hits 52.9 in May; Construction spending up 1.9% in April

Please check back for updates.. The ISM non-manufacturing PMI was expected to hit 55.5 in May, Thomson Reuters said, versus 55.7 in April. Economists expected factory orders to rise 1.9 percent in April, after rising 1.5 percent in March, according to a Thomson Reuters consensus estimate....(read more)
